How much VRAM does GLM 5.2 W4AFP8 need?

GLM 5.2 W4AFP8 requires 239.3 GB of VRAM at Q4_K_M, or 787.9 GB at BF16. Full 1049K context adds up to 2006.1 GB (2245.5 GB total).

VRAM = Weights + KV Cache + Overhead

Weights = 391.9B × 4.8 bits ÷ 8 = 235.1 GB

KV Cache + Overhead 4.2 GB (at 2K context + ~0.3 GB framework)

KV Cache + Overhead 2010.4 GB (at full 1049K context)

How fast is GLM 5.2 W4AFP8?

At Q4_K_M, GLM 5.2 W4AFP8 can reach ~18 tok/s on AMD Instinct MI350X. Speed depends mainly on GPU memory bandwidth. Real-world results typically within ±20%.

tok/s = (bandwidth GB/s ÷ model GB) × efficiency

Example: NVIDIA B3008000 ÷ 239.3 × 0.65 = ~22 tok/s
